Understanding VINs: Essential Insights for Used Car Buyers

Purchasing a used vehicle is a major decision, and knowing how to leverage the vital information contained within its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) can significantly impact your buying experience. This unique code, typically located on the dashboard, acts as a fingerprint to the car's history and specifications. By carefully examining the VIN, you can uncover valuable clues about its past, may saving you from costly surprises down the road.

  • First and foremost, a VIN can reveal the car's manufacturer and production year. This data is essential for determining its estimation in the used market.
  • Furthermore, a VIN can provide traceability of past repairs, accidents, and even ownership changes. This valuable data can highlight potential issues that may not be immediately obvious during a visual inspection.
